Arrest Made Following Burglary at Forrest Avenue Valero Station 12-14-2020

Narrative:
The Dover Police Department arrested a 19-year-old man after committing a burglary at the Valero station on Forrest Avenue on Sunday morning. At approximately 2:55 a.m., officers responded to the store for a burglary alarm. When a manager responded, it was determined that the suspect (Christopher Mosley) was a former employee off the business. Mosley entered the business, possibly with a key, and attempted to open the ATM with another key. Mosley failed to gain access to the ATM and then stole 14 packs of cigarettes before fleeing on foot. A short time later, officers located Mosley at a nearby business and took him into custody without incident.
Mosley was released on an O.R. bond on the following charges:
-Wearing a Disguise During Commission of Felony
-Burglary 3rd Degree
-Theft Under $1,500
